Answer:

y-intercept: (0,100)

x-intercept: (-250,0)

Explanation:

The x-intercept is where the line passes through the x-axis. The y-intercept is where the line passes through the y-axis. The way to write the x-intercept is by writing the number on the line then a comma and then 0 for the y. For example: in your picture, the x-intercept is (-250,0). The same is for the y-intercept.
